Terps Haul In Another Recruit

More good news for the Maryland men's basketball team.  According to TurtleSportsReport.com, Maryland added 6-foot-9 Steve Goins for next year, a huge boost for the team.

 

Goins, from Chicago, committed several weeks ago but just recently found out he had sufficient grades.
